Digg StumbleUpon LinkedIn YouTube Flickr Facebook Twitter RSS Reset

C/C++: Afficher les limites de chaque type de varibles


{filelink=13744}

#include <stdio.h>
#include < limits.h >
#include <float.h>      
 
void main()
{
  printf("La limite de 'char' varie entre  %d et %dn", CHAR_MIN, CHAR_MAX); 
 
  printf("La limite de 'unsigned char' varie entre  0 et %un", UCHAR_MAX);
 
  printf("La limite de 'short' varie entre  %d et %dn", SHRT_MIN, SHRT_MAX);
 
  printf("La limite de 'unsigned short' varie entre  0 et %un", USHRT_MAX);
 
  printf("La limite de 'int' varie entre  %d et %dn", INT_MIN, INT_MAX);
 
  printf("La limite de 'unsigned int' varie entre  0 et %un", UINT_MAX);
 
  printf("La limite de 'long' varie entre  %d et %dn", LONG_MIN, LONG_MAX);
 
  printf("La limite de 'unsigned long' varie entre  0 et %un", ULONG_MAX);
 
  printf("La plus petite valeur de 'float' est %.3en", FLT_MIN);
  printf("La plus grande taille de type 'float' est %.3en", FLT_MAX);
 
  printf("La plus petite taille de valeur de type 'double' est %.3en",DBL_MIN);
  printf("La plus grande taille de type 'double' est %.3en", DBL_MAX);
 
  printf("La plus petite taille de valeur de type 'long double' est %.3en",DBL_MIN);
  printf("La plus grande taille de type 'long double' est %.3en",DBL_MAX);
}

No comments yet.

Leave a Comment